I think it's fitting that this 1970 MPC Dodge Coronet Super Bee is first to cross the finishing line in 2024. Actually finishing this 2 years to the day after I started it, which is not bad considering my 1st car project took me over 4 years! The kit has it's issues, mainly cleaning up the body and chrome pieces, but the details is good. I added plug wires and a few other details such as resin door handles and replacing the side markers with aluminum tape. Painted MCW Limelight Green Metallic lacquer.
